报告摘要(Abstract)

First-order modal logic (FOML) provides a natural logical language for reasoning about modal attitudes, while retaining the richness of quantification for referring to predicates over domains. However, FOML is notoriously bad computationally, as most of the useful fragments of the logic are undecidable, over many model classes. Over the years, only a few fragments (such as the monodic fragment) have been shown to be decidable under heavy restrictions on the syntax. In this talk, I survey our recent work on the newly discovered bundled fragments based on constructions bundling quantifiers and modalities together. The idea came from our earlier work on epistemic logics of know-how/why/what, and it led us to many expressive and decidable fragments of FOML without restricting the number of variables or the arity of the predicates. I will give an almost complete picture of the (un)decidability of all the basic bundled fragments of FOML over increasing and constant domain models. I conclude with some future directions.


主讲人简介(Bio)


王彦晶,阿姆斯特丹大学逻辑学博士,现任北京大学哲学系长聘教授、副系主任,北京大学逻辑、语言与认知中心主任,中国逻辑学会副会长,中国数学会数理逻辑专业委员会副主任,Journal of Philosophical Logic及Journal of Logic, Language and Information副主编,入选国家“万人计划”哲学与社会科学领军人才。专长为模态逻辑的基础理论及其在哲学、理论计算机以及人工智能中的应用。个人主页:wangyanjing.com
